More Than 1 Million Children Were Victims of Identity Theft in 2017

Kids are easy targets for identity thieves — and they're becoming more common ones, as well. A new report from Javelin Strategy & Research says that in 2017, more than 1 million children in the United States were victims of identity theft, resulting in $2.6 billion in losses.
